Downers Grove Library Returns To Curbside Pickup Only
The library is offering curbside pickup only starting Monday.

DOWNERS GROVE, IL — Due to the new coronavirus crisis, the Downers Grove Public Library will only offer curbside pickup starting Monday.
The library has set up three parking spots on Curtiss Street for curbside pickup. Library staff will bring out curbside pickup items and place them in the patron's trunk.
For returns, patrons can use the four book drops that are located on Curtiss Street and Forest Avenue.

In a news release, library officials said, "The health and safety of the Downers Grove Community is at the forefront of our decision-making. The reimplementation of Curbside Pickup has been carefully considered and planned, with great attention to safe material handling, social distancing, and workflow."
The library has put additional measures in place to help ensure the safety of staff and patrons. These measures include:

- Staff report to work only if they (and family members) are healthy.
- Limited staff members are allowed in the building at the same time.
- Social distancing guidelines are closely followed.
- Curbside Pickup procedures are designed to be contactless.
- PPE is provided for staff members. All staff are encouraged to wash their hands frequently.
- Workspaces are regularly cleaned with sanitizer.
